Investing KRW 211.5 billion in OLED new market creation and small business R&D

The government will provide approximately KRW 900 billion in policy financing to secure display competitiveness and invest KRW 211.5 billion in creating new OLED markets and R&D for small and medium-sized businesses.

On the 18th, the Ministry of Trade, Industry and Energy held a meeting with companies to discuss investment in the display industry and resolution of difficulties, chaired by First Vice Minister Jang Young-jin.

The meeting was attended by executives from LG Display and Samsung Display, as well as presidents of small and medium-sized enterprises such as Dongjin Semichem, AP Systems, and MKP, as well as the president of the Korea Electronics Technology Institute and the vice president of the Korea Display Industry Association, who are supporters.

Companies attending the meeting raised various suggestions, including the designation of display-specialized complexes and expansion of tax benefits, policy financing support to promote new investment, and expansion of government R&D for small and medium-sized enterprises.

Panel companies said they hope to expedite the designation of advanced strategic industry detailed technologies and specialized complexes so that they can further secure next-generation display competitiveness, and that the national strategic technology legislative process can be completed quickly.

Small and medium-sized enterprises emphasized that small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) technologies should be included in national strategic technologies in addition to panel technologies, and requested preemptive government support, such as expanded SME R&D and policy financing.

Accordingly, Vice Minister of Trade, Industry and Energy Jang Young-jin said, “Recent domestic and international conditions have made it difficult for companies to survive with their own capabilities. He said, “This is a difficult situation,” and “the government and the private sector must work together as a team to respond.”

He continued, “To support the proactive investment and innovation efforts of display companies, the government designated displays as a cutting-edge industry and established a dedicated display organization within the Ministry of Trade, Industry and Energy.”

He also said, "We will expedite the designation of detailed technologies for advanced strategic industries and actively review applications from the display industry for designation as specialized complexes, taking into account comprehensive consideration of designation requirements under the 'National Advanced Strategic Industry Special Act.'"

Regarding the suggestions of small and medium-sized enterprises, he said, “We will actively persuade the relevant ministries to include small and medium-sized enterprises technologies in national strategic technologies,” and “Through consultations with the Financial Services Commission, we will provide policy financing of approximately 900 billion won to the display sector, and invest 211.5 billion won this year in OLED new market creation demonstration R&D and small and medium-sized enterprises R&D, to secure industrial competitiveness.”

Meanwhile, in 2022, the display industry recorded exports of $21.1 billion, a 1.1% decrease year-on-year, as global demand declined following the end of the COVID-19 pandemic. Private investment focused on expanding the operating rates of existing production lines rather than new investments.

This year, the market for high-value-added OLED products is expected to increase by 1.5% to $21.5 billion, expanding from mobile to IT, transparent OLED, and automotive displays.

Private investment is expected to expand beyond the 6th generation to the 8th generation, as demand for OLEDs in IT products is expected to increase.
